Output 8e6754023cc8342085c7d59b65715f0f7965f15d4e0af0c2bf0b068da2217e33:1

value
183335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b796a99198b635b8d9a5c98f7903f62a98721e OP_EQUAL
address
3QdyTeWXxCGyc7CBNjskusifGm6KGNbHW3
transaction
8e6754023cc8342085c7d59b65715f0f7965f15d4e0af0c2bf0b068da2217e33
confirmations
140949
spent
true